Get Data Scrapping Solutions

Discussion or questions/answers on any type of development (Web or Android or Desktop Application)
#45398
Why Streamlining Code Optimization Matters for Faster Load Times on Websites

Streamlining code optimization is crucial in modern web development. As more and more businesses move their operations online, website speed has become a significant factor in user experience (UX) and search engine rankings. A website that loads quickly can improve user satisfaction, reduce bounce rates, and increase engagement. For developers, understanding how to optimize code effectively not only enhances the performance of your site but also ensures it meets the expectations set by today's fast-paced internet environment.

Core Concepts for Code Optimization

To optimize web pages efficiently, developers must grasp several key concepts:

- Minification: This involves removing unnecessary characters from source code without affecting its functionality. Minifying CSS and JavaScript files can reduce file sizes significantly.
- Compression: GZIP compression is a widely used technique that reduces the size of files transmitted over the network by compressing them before sending them to the client, then decompressing them on the user’s browser.
- Caching: Caching involves storing frequently accessed resources in memory or local storage so they can be retrieved faster. This can drastically reduce load times for repeat visits.

Practical Applications and Best Practices

Implementing these optimizations can lead to substantial improvements in your website's performance:

-
Code: Select all
// Example of minifying JavaScript
const minified = uglify.minify('path/to/script.js', { fromString: true });
fs.writeFileSync('path/to/minified-script.js', minified.code);
- Ensure you are using a content delivery network (CDN) to distribute your static assets. CDNs cache and serve resources from geographically distributed servers, reducing latency.

Common mistakes include:

- Overlooking the importance of server-side optimization such as optimizing images and videos.
- Neglecting to use modern tools like Webpack for bundling and tree-shaking.
- Failing to test the performance after implementing optimizations on a staging environment before deploying to production.

Conclusion

Streamlining code optimization is an essential skill in web development. By understanding core concepts such as minification, compression, and caching, developers can significantly enhance their site's load times and user experience. Remember to avoid common pitfalls and continuously test your implementation to ensure optimal performance. With these strategies, you can create faster, more responsive websites that deliver a better browsing experience for users.
    Similar Topics
    TopicsStatisticsLast post
    0 Replies 
    198 Views
    by masum
    Streamlining Code Optimization for Faster Load Times
    by shayan    - in: Development
    0 Replies 
    172 Views
    by shayan
    0 Replies 
    212 Views
    by tamim
    0 Replies 
    149 Views
    by shohag
    0 Replies 
    169 Views
    by shayan
    InterServer Web Hosting and VPS
    long long title how many chars? lets see 123 ok more? yes 60

    We have created lots of YouTube videos just so you can achieve [...]

    Another post test yes yes yes or no, maybe ni? :-/

    The best flat phpBB theme around. Period. Fine craftmanship and [...]

    Do you need a super MOD? Well here it is. chew on this

    All you need is right here. Content tag, SEO, listing, Pizza and spaghetti [...]

    Lasagna on me this time ok? I got plenty of cash

    this should be fantastic. but what about links,images, bbcodes etc etc? [...]

    Data Scraping Solutions